I hate winter…
Just so you all know, let me be perfectly clear: Winter sucks big time. I ran 11 km today in 1:34:12 (an 8:34 pace) and it was bitterly cold with a stiff breeze. It was – 21 C to -27 C with the wind chill. I was not over or under dressed. The most important items not to forget are the toque, and a neck tube, the areas of your body that lose the most heat. I have never had a problem with cold feet even with my everyday socks because there is so much warm blood being pumped through that it makes no never mind. I had on four layers, one cool max t-shirt, one long sleeve cool max, a long sleeve sweater and a thin windbreaker. I had gloves too. Make no mistake, you will get wet from perspiration, but better wet than frozen. As for the icy … Continue reading
